Description
The A3240 Hall-effect switch is an extremely tempera-
ture-stable and stress-resistant sensor especially suited for
operation over extended tem per a ture ranges to +150°C.
Superior high-temperature per for mance is made possible
through dynamic offset cancellation, which reduces the
residual offset voltage normally caused by device overmolding,
tem per a ture de pen den cies, and thermal stress.
The device includes on a single silicon chip a voltage regulator,
Hall-voltage generator, small-signal amplifier, chopper
sta bi li za tion, Schmitt trigger, and a short-circuit protected
open-collector output to sink up to 25 mA. A south pole of
sufficient strength will turn the output on. An on-board regulator
permits operation with supply voltages of 4.2 to 24 volts.
Three package styles provide a magnetically op ti mized pack age
for most ap pli ca tions. Package type LH is a modified SOT23W
surface-mount package, LT is a miniature SOT89/TO-243AA
transistor package for surface-mount applications; while UA is
a three-lead ultra-mini-SIP for through-hole mounting. The LH
and UA packages are also available in a lead (Pb) free version
(suffix, –T) , with a 100% matte tin plated leadframe.
